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ners sometimes confuse 'marine' with 'maritime'; 'maritime' refers more to human activities related to the sea, while 'marine' refers to the natural sea environment.
Kahulugan
Related to the sea or ocean

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ners may confuse 'marine' (soldier) with 'sailor'; sailors mainly work on ships, while marines are trained for combat on both land and sea.
Kahulugan
A navy's infantry soldier

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ners sometimes confuse this with 'maritime', which is more widely used for human-related sea activities; 'marine' here is more technical or formal.
Kahulugan
Related to shipping or seafaring
